Choosing a Fractional CFO
Finding the right fractional CFO can greatly impact your company's monetary performance. Here are some key aspects to keep in mind during the procurement:
* **Expertise and Experience:** Look for a CFO with a proven track record in your industry.
Understand their skills in areas like budgeting.
* **Communication Skills:** Effective communication is vital for a successful partnership. Choose a CFO who can concisely communicate complex economic information to both technical and non-technical audiences.
* **Cultural Fit:** Consider your company's environment. You want a CFO who integrates well with your team and work style.
* **Flexibility and Adaptability:** Fractional CFOs often function across multiple companies. Choose someone who is versatile and can tailor their contributions to meet your specific needs.
* **References and Testimonials:** Don't hesitate to seek references from previous clients. Success stories can provide valuable insights into the CFO's efficacy.
Hiring A Fractional CFO Over A Full-Time Position Delivers Benefits
Fractional CFOs provide crucial financial expertise to organizations without the commitment of a full-time employee. This adjustable arrangement allows owners to access top-tier guidance on a project basis, which can be significantly beneficial for startup companies.
By harnessing the expertise of a fractional CFO, businesses can streamline their financial functions, boost decision-making, and ultimately drive profitability.
Here are some key perks of choosing a fractional CFO over a full-time position:
* Budget Savings: Fractional CFOs typically come at a lesser cost than full-time employees, eliminating overhead charges.
* Specialized Expertise: Fractional CFOs often have comprehensive experience in targeted industries or areas of finance, providing tailored solutions to your unique needs.
* Flexibility: Fractional CFO arrangements can be quickly adjusted to check here accommodate changing business needs.
* Objective Perspective: A fractional CFO can offer an outside perspective on your financial strategies, helping to identify areas for improvement.
